Teaching by Using Fun Math Games

 

Teachers Are always looking for new ways to engage their students and to help them learn about Mathematics.

There are lots of ways to make maths fun in class. Most Experts agree that if children are having fun whilst they are learning than they will be more engaged and enthusiastic about the subject that they are being taught.

Fun Maths games can be used to help primary school children learn place value concepts, improve multiplication recall, explore properties of numbers understand percentages, understand fractions, practice addition and even more.

These fun maths games help children to learn, understand and explore math principals in ways conventional teaching does not do.

The challenge for primary school teachers and parents of primary school children is to have the courage to implement these Fun math games in a class room environment.

A maths class with a rigid, structured text-book/worksheet approach does not motivate or inspire students.

You may be astounded at the results you can achieve if, in your class if you have the courage to use a more hands on exploratory teaching approach by using fun maths games.
